Two different modes to print / log data are available:
1.

Timed logging

; samples are stored and printed (if print function is

active) at fixed time intervals. Data are stored in the lots 01 to 16.

2.

Log on demand

; samples are stored and printed (if print function

is active) when the LOG key is pressed. Data are stored in the lot
00. It's possible to perform the Log on demand either in normal
mode or in Timed logging mode.

It is possible to switch from logging without printing to logging with
printing in two ways:
• set the function code 03 to "On" to enable printing, to "Off" to

disable printing

• press ALT and PAPER to toggle between printer enabled and

printer disabled while in Timed logging.

TIMED LOGGING MODE

To start Timed logging, press ALT and LOG.
The lot number will be displayed for a few
seconds then the LOG symbol will appear on
LCD and if printer is enabled a first set of
data will be printed. The "LOG" symbol will
be fixed if printer is enabled and will blink if
printer is disabled.
The printout provides the following information:

a - Lot number
b - Logging interval
c - Date (only for the first printed

sample of the lot or of the day)

d - Sample number
e - Time
f - Readings ("----" means out of range).

Note

: channels with no probe connected are not logged nor printed.

If no keys are pressed, the meter enters standby mode to prolong the
battery life and only the "LOG" indication will be visible on LCD. While
logging, during the sleep mode, the last logged reading will appear
briefly on the LCD. To reactivate the LCD press ON/OFF.

To prepare the instrument for use, choose the most appropriate tem-
perature probe(s) for your application (see accessories) and connect it
(them) to the connector(s) located on the top of the instrument.
All the probes have been precalibrated at the factory and no calibra-
tion is needed.
With the meter facing you, channel #1 is the first
connector on the top left hand side.
Press the ON/OFF key to power on the instrument.
To take temperature measurements, simply
insert the probe in the sample to be tested
and allow the reading to stabilize. The tem-
perature is displayed on the upper LCD. The
lower LCD displays the selected channel num-
ber (multi-channel versions only).
The meter selects channel 1 as default. Press CH/
TIME (HI98740 and HI98840 only) or TEMP/TIME
(HI98710, HI98810 only) to view the reading of
the other channels, date and time in the following
order:
• channel 2 temperature reading (HI98740, HI98840 only)
• channel 3 temperature reading (HI98740, HI98840 only)
• channel 4 temperature reading (HI98740, HI98840 only)
• date
• time
Pressing CH/TIME or TEMP/TIME again, the meter returns to channel 1
temperature reading.
If the reading is out of range or the probe is
not connected to a channel, the LCD will
display a dashed line in place of the reading.

Note:

To choose between "°C " and "°F" unit, enter the setup code 70.

Note:

The meter is factory calibrated. After 1
year since last calibration the "DATE"
symbol starts blinking on the LCD to
warn the user that a recalibration is suggested to maintain the
greatest accuracy of the meter. It is recommended that recali-
bration is performed by authorized technical personnel only.
Contact your nearest HANNA service center.
